#7c93d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c93d2 is composed of 48.6% red, 57.6%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41% cyan, 30%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 48.9% and a lightness of 65.5%. #7c93d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#0027a5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#7c93d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c93d2 has RGB values of R:124, G:147,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 8164306.

Shades and Tints of #7c93d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c93d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5a6a9 is the less saturated color, while #5380fb is the most saturated one.
